[FISEA 1988] Paper: Henry Flurry – The Creation Station: An Approach to a Multimedia Workstation

ABSTRACT

The Center for Performing Arts and Technology at the University of Michigan is developing the Creation Station, a workstation-based software package that will provide the artist advanced sound synthesis and graphics capabilities, as well as the tools necessary to create multimedia pieces of art. This paper discusses the design criteria, programming obstacles and implementation details of the Creation Station. Because the Creation Station is coded in Objective-C, a brief tutorial on Object-Oriented Programming Languages is included.
